


Academician Ni Guangnan: RISC-V has become the most popular chip architecture in China
According to news from this site on August 23, according to the official public account of the Beijing Economic and Information Technology Bureau, the 2023 RISC-V China Summit opened in Beijing today , Ni Guangnan, academician of the Chinese Academy of Engineering, RISC-V International Foundation CEO Calista Redmond, summit chairperson and deputy director of the Institute of Software, Chinese Academy of Sciences Wu Yanjun, and deputy director of the Institute of Computing Technology of the Chinese Academy of Sciences Bao Yungang attended the opening ceremony of the summit and delivered speeches. Calista Red Demond delivered a keynote speech at the conference.

During the meeting, Academician Ni Guangnan said, “RISC -V’s future lies in China, and China’s semiconductor chip industry also needs RISC-V. Open source RISC-V has become the most popular chip architecture in the Chinese industry.”
Ni Guangnan also said thatChina is willing to embrace open source, innovate collaboratively with the world, and strive to create a strong and prosperous RISC-V ecosystem, which will strongly support RISC-V to become one of the world's mainstream CPUs.
After inquiries, this site learned that the RISC-V Summit is organized by the RISC-V International Foundation and is held annually in North America, Europe, and China. It is the highest-level and most influential event in the global RISC-V field. Annual Summit. It is reported that this summit is the third China Summit. Focusing on the theme of "RISC-V ecological co-construction", it adopts the method of "main forum theme report exhibition exhibition concurrent event poster", covering more than 100 Theme reports, 16 concurrent activities, 18 corporate booths, 16 community booths, 67 posters and 31 poster appointment exchanges, with more than 2,000 registrations. With more than 800 participating companies, more than 50 investment institutions, and more than 70 universities and colleges, it will become the largest, richest and most influential summit in the history of the RISC-V Summit.
